Biography
American actor particularly known for his roles in television westerns during the 1960s. He played U.S. Marshal Will Foreman in the 1960–1962 NBC series Outlaws. From 1967 to 1971, he was cast as Sam Butler, the ranch foreman, in sixty-two episodes of NBC's The High Chaparral.
Prior to his lead role in Outlaws, Collier appeared in the first seasons of both CBS's long-running Gunsmoke (1955) and NBC's powerhouse western Bonanza (1959). He guest-starred in 1957 in NBC's Wagon Train with Ward Bond during its first year on the air.
Collier made more than seventy film and television appearances. He appeared with John Wayne, Robert Mitchum, Anthony Quinn, Dean Martin, Tom Selleck, James Arness, and Elvis Presley.
His son, Donald Homer Mounger Jr., was born on 27 September 1955 in Los Angeles, and died at age 61 in March 2017 from diabetes.
On 13 September 2021, Don Collier died of lung cancer in Harrodsburg, Kentucky at age 92.
